Каждая ИС из семейства 1-Wire содержит ПЗУ, в котором хранится уникальный 64-разрядный идентификационный код (ИК). Данный код может использоваться для адресации или идентификации конкретной ИС на шине. Идентификатор состоит из трех частей: 8 бит кода семейства, 48 бит серийного номера и 8 бит CRC-кода, вычисленного от первых 56 бит. Имеется небольшой набор команд, который работает совместно с 64-разр. ИК. Эти команды называются команды функций ПЗУ. В таблице 2 приведен перечень шести команду ПЗУ.
Таблица 2 – Команды ПЗУ
Команда | Код | Назначение |
READ ROM (ЧТЕНИЕ ПЗУ) | 33H | Идентификация |
SKIP ROM (ПРОПУСК ПЗУ) | CCH | Пропуск адресации |
MATCH ROM (СОВПАДЕНИЕ ПЗУ) | 55H | Адресация подчиненного устройства |
SEARCH ROM (ПОИСК ПЗУ) | F0H | Получение идентификационных данных о всех устройствах на шине |
OVERDRIVE SKIP ROM | 3CH | Ускоренная версия SKIP ROM |
OVERDRIVE MATCH ROM | 69H | Ускоренная версия MATCH ROM |